ABSTRACT
Lower limb lengthening, especially femur lengthening and tibia lengthening, is the most commonly used and effective technique in management of limb length discrepancy and dwarfism. However, there are many complications and sequelae in clinic practice, which limits the application and development of this technique to some extent. The reasons may be related to the following two points one is the lack of sub discipline of limb lengthening in the domestic system of health and medical education, in other word, it is difficult acquired academic and clinical guidance from specialty of "Limb Lengthening and Reconstruction" in orthopedics departments and hospitals. Secondly, limb lengthening and reconstruction with its own theoretical principles and medical model is a systematic engineering and integration discipline, which cannot be completely guided by the classical orthopedic medical paradigm. The complications of lower limb lengthening have been classified according to local and general, immediate, early and late stage, or by infection and non-infection, or by problems, obstacles, complications, etc. Regarding the nature, Qin proposed a new classification for complications, which is divided into five categories from soft tissue, from joint, from bone, infective and complex. This classification method can reflect the characteristics of different types, reflect the progressive relationship, and is easy to record, distinguish, emphasize and avoid. Different types of complications can occur in different stages of lower limb lengthening, different kinds of complications can occur alone or simultaneous, and different degrees of complications can transform into each other. It requires that surgeon engaged in limb lengthening must have solid knowledge of orthopedics, and be able to quickly identify and effectively deal with various complications; the patients should fully understand and implement the key points of each step during the whole process of limb lengthening, doctors and patients should be friends to avoid and reduce the occurrence of complications.
